Port Stories
Port Stories is an exhibition and interactive trail in and around Shoreham Port. Local residents have been working with artists to collect stories from people who have lived and worked around the Port. We’ve explored the Port through photography, sound recording and video to create this work which is full of personal stories and responses to this amazing place on our doorstep.

About Figment Arts
Figment Arts works with communities to create meaningful artistic projects that celebrate local heritage and stories. This exhibition is a collaboration between professional artists and local residents who have deep connections to Shoreham Port.
Port Stories is part of the Adur Festival 2026 ‘Revival’ theme - celebrating the return of community storytelling and shared heritage.
